As a Communications Coordinator, you play a vital role in creating a welcoming, informed, and positive experience for residents and their families. You’ll coordinate communication, support events, and ensure that all residents feel connected and valued. Schedule & Pay: Full-Time | Monday–Friday | 8:30 AM – 5:00 PM | $28.00/hour Requirements · Associate degree or equivalent experience required. · Excellent written and verbal communication skills. · Proficiency with Microsoft Office products. · Experience with Canva, Adobe Express, or similar programs preferred. Responsibilities · Coordinate move-ins and serve as the primary contact for residents and their families. · Update and maintain resident handbooks and informational materials. · Manage resident communications, including phone directories, admission/move-out notifications, and announcements. · Lead the Commons Welcome Committee and support Resident Experience events. · Create signage and materials to enhance the resident environment. · Handle contract signing and support transfers to new levels of care. · Support resident satisfaction surveys and assist with Life Enrichment activities. · Coordinate annual resident anniversaries, holiday cards, and other recognition initiatives. · Assist with admissions processes, including background checks, contract packages, and documentation. · Maintain accurate resident records and demographic information in PathTracker and PCC. Benefits: Central Baptist Village offers full-time employees benefit plans including medical, dental, vision, life insurance, short and long term disability, flexible spending, paid vacation, paid holidays, and a 401(k) plan with employer match. CBV also provides an employee assistance program and access to an on-site fitness center.
